#3fac04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3fac04 is composed of 24.7% red, 67.5%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.7%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 98.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 34.5%. #3fac04 color hex could be obtained by blending #7eff08 with #005900.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#3fac04 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3fac04 has RGB values of R:63, G:172,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 4172804.

Shades and Tints of #3fac04
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#071300 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3fac04
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575b55 is the less saturated color, while #3fac04 is the most saturated one.
